Here's a list of all the significant updates that has been made to the website, sorted from newest to oldest.
The list of updates for the generators, if they have them, are listed in their page.

Current status of the site


As most of you have noticed, the website has been failing a lot during the last week.

A few measures have been taken to prevent this, and more of them are on the way. It seems the generators are operational again, but I can't guarantee they won't fail again.

I will keep investigating and applying fixes, and I may upgrade the host eventually to be even more sure that situations like this don't happen again.

Thank you so much for your patience and understanding.

